Course Summary

About the course

This course is specifically aimed at International students, supporting those wishing to gain practical work based experiential learning. Together with studying your chosen course we are offering you the opportunity to secure a placement* for an additional 6 months, making the course 18 months in length. This allows students with limited experience to put into practice the skills and techniques developed throughout the Master’s degree.

Our Master's course is designed to meet the demand for a new kind of IT specialist with the skills and knowledge in data science.

The total demand in ‘big data’ users is set to rise to around 644,000 across all industries. More connectivity means more data and UK companies are leading the way in collecting, processing and understanding it. It’s estimated that 31,000 people work in specialist big data roles in the UK and the talent pipeline, together with demand, should see that increase by 243% over the next 5 years.*

In order to address these demands, given the large amount of data collected by all kinds of organisations, graduates of the course aims to equip graduates with an understanding of:

statistics
data mining techniques
big data and associated file systems
data visualisation

Our aim is for you to graduate from this course with the ability to combine this knowledge to provide solutions to novel problems associated with the organisation and the analysis of data.

The course seeks to develop the ability to critically evaluate existing and emerging Data Science technology, apply knowledge, understanding and analytical and design skills in support of analytical and big data problems.

Modules

With ever-increasing advancements in Internet-of-Things, Cyber-Physical Systems, and social media applications, huge volumes of complex and multi-dimensional datasets are being generated every day. Visually analysing these datasets facilitates the transformation of raw data into valuable knowledge and information. The biggest challenge is to articulate suitable solutions of complex analytical problems by visually interacting with the designed artefacts without going into underlying complexities. Tremendous endeavours have been devoted to streamline innovative solutions, novel methods, tools, processes and methodologies to address underlying challenges. This module aims to provide students with core knowledge and deep understanding of advanced theories underpinning data visualisation, best practices in using visualisation artefacts effectively and practical skills in implementing the theoretical knowledge into certain application domains. Students will be engaged in practical utilisation of state-of-the-art visualisation tools and methods to understand real-world big data problems, and to rectify complex issues with visual analysis. Topics that will be covered in this module include exploratory data visualisation; data visualisation theories, existing and emerging interactive 2D and 3D visualisation toolkits, and application of visualisation skillset in application specific domains.
